multiprocess download file by http range headers

import argparse | |
import collections | |
import http.client | |
import multiprocessing | |
import os | |
import re | |
import time | |
from multiprocessing import Queue, Lock, Process | |
from select import poll, POLLIN | |
from urllib.parse import urlparse | |
Setting = collections.namedtuple("Setting", "host path process size verbose output length") | |
class HeadError(Exception): | |
pass | |
class RangeError(HeadError): | |
pass | |
def _is_active(sock): | |
if sock is not None: | |
p = poll() | |
p.register(sock, POLLIN) | |
for fno, ev in p.poll(0.0): | |
if fno == sock.fileno(): | |
return False | |
else: | |
return True | |
return False | |
def is_valid_url(url): | |
regex = re.compile( | |
r'^(?:http)s?://' | |
r'(?:(?:[A-Z0-9](?:[A-Z0-9-]{0,61}[A-Z0-9])?\.)+(?:[A-Z]{2,6}\.?|[A-Z0-9-]{2,}\.?)|' | |
r'localhost|' | |
r'\d{1,3}\.\d{1,3}\.\d{1,3}\.\d{1,3})' | |
r'(?::\d+)?' | |
r'(?:/?|[/?]\S+)$', re.IGNORECASE) | |
if not regex.match(url): | |
raise ValueError("url is invalid") | |
else: | |
return url | |
def download(host, path, output, lock, q): | |
connection = http.client.HTTPConnection(host) | |
connection.connect() | |
while 1: | |
time.sleep(1) | |
if not _is_active(connection.sock): | |
connection = http.client.HTTPConnection(host) | |
connection.connect() | |
item, output_seek = q.get() | |
try: | |
print(item, output_seek) | |
if item is None: | |
break | |
else: | |
connection.request("GET", path, headers={"range": item}) | |
response = connection.getresponse() | |
if response.status == 200: | |
pass | |
if response.status == 206: | |
with lock: | |
if output_seek > 0: | |
output_seek += 1 | |
f = os.open(output, os.O_WRONLY) | |
os.lseek(f, output_seek, os.SEEK_SET) | |
os.write(f, response.read()) | |
os.close(f) | |
except (http.client.HTTPException, ConnectionResetError) as e: | |
print(e) | |
q.put((item, output_seek)) | |
continue | |
except Exception as e: | |
q.put((item, output_seek)) | |
print(e) | |
break | |
connection.close() | |
def unsupport_range_download(host, path, output): | |
connection = http.client.HTTPConnection(host) | |
with open(output, "wb") as f: | |
connection.request('GET', path) | |
response = connection.getresponse() | |
f.write(response.read()) | |
def get_url_length(host, path): | |
connection = http.client.HTTPConnection(host) | |
connection.request('HEAD', path) | |
response = connection.getresponse() | |
if response.status == 302: | |
location = response.getheader("location") | |
if location is not None: | |
return get_url_length(*parse_url(location)) | |
raise HeadError("302 not found location") | |
else: | |
if not response.getheader("accept-ranges"): | |
raise RangeError("not support range header") | |
length = response.getheader("content-length") | |
connection.close() | |
return int(length) | |
def create_hole_file(length, filename): | |
with open(filename, "wb") as f: | |
f.write(b'0' * length) | |
def parse_url(url): | |
_, host, path, *_ = urlparse(url) | |
return host, path or '/' | |
def calculate_process_size(length, size, process): | |
if size >= length: | |
process = 1 | |
if length <= size * process: | |
process, _ = divmod(length, size) | |
process += 1 | |
return size, process | |
def add_item_to_queue(length, size, p): | |
queue = Queue() | |
a, b = divmod(length, size) | |
for i in range(a + 1): | |
if i == 0: | |
queue.put(("bytes={}-{}".format(0, (i + 1) * size), 0)) | |
elif i == a: | |
queue.put(("bytes={}-{}".format(i * size + 1, length), i * size)) | |
else: | |
queue.put(("bytes={}-{}".format(i * size + 1, (i + 1) * size), i * size)) | |
else: | |
for i in range(p): | |
queue.put((None, None)) | |
return queue | |
def main(): | |
parser = argparse.ArgumentParser() | |
parser.add_argument("-u", '--url', nargs=1, type=is_valid_url, help="scrawle url", required=True) | |
parser.add_argument("-p", nargs='?', default=10, type=int, help="process default 10") | |
parser.add_argument("-o", nargs=1, type=str, help="output") | |
parser.add_argument("-s", nargs='?', default=1000000, type=int, help="range size default 1000000") | |
parser.add_argument("-v", action="store_true") | |
args = parser.parse_args() | |
host, path = parse_url(args.url[0]) | |
*_, filename = path.split("/") | |
output = args.o or filename or host | |
try: | |
length = get_url_length(host, path) | |
size, process = calculate_process_size(length, args.s, args.p) | |
create_hole_file(length, output) | |
setting = Setting(host=host, process=process, size=size, verbose=args.v, output=output, path=path, | |
length=length) | |
queue = add_item_to_queue(setting.length, setting.size, setting.process) | |
lock = Lock() | |
processes = [] | |
print(setting) | |
for i in range(setting.process): | |
p = Process(target=download, args=(setting.host, setting.path, setting.output, lock, queue)) | |
processes.append(p) | |
p.start() | |
while 1: | |
try: | |
pid, return_code = os.wait() | |
print(pid, return_code) | |
except ChildProcessError: | |
break | |
# for p in processes: | |
# p.join() | |
except RangeError as e: | |
print(e) | |
unsupport_range_download(host, path, output) | |
if __name__ == '__main__': | |
main() |
